查询订单列表
<h1>查询订单列表接口开发文档</h1>
<h2>一、接口概述</h2>
<p>该接口主要用于商户进行订单列表查询,适用于对账操作或同步订单状态等业务场景,方便商户获取和管理订单信息。</p>
<h2>二、接口基本信息</h2>
<ol>
<li><strong>请求地址</strong>:<code>https://pay.lmwa.cn/api/merchant/orders</code></li>
<li><strong>请求方式</strong>:POST</li>
</ol>
<h2>三、请求参数说明</h2>
<table>
<thead>
<tr>
<th>字段名</th>
<th>变量名</th>
<th>必填</th>
<th>类型</th>
<th>示例值</th>
<th>描述</th>
</tr>
</thead>
<tbody>
<tr>
<td>商户 ID</td>
<td>pid</td>
<td>是</td>
<td>Int</td>
<td>1001</td>
<td>商户在支付平台的唯一标识,用于确定查询的订单所属商户</td>
</tr>
<tr>
<td>查询偏移</td>
<td>offset</td>
<td>是</td>
<td>Int</td>
<td>0</td>
<td>表示查询的起始位置,从 0 开始计数,用于分页查询。例如,offset 为 0 表示从第一条数据开始查询,offset 为 50 表示从第 51 条数据开始查询</td>
</tr>
<tr>
<td>每页条数</td>
<td>limit</td>
<td>是</td>
<td>Int</td>
<td>50</td>
<td>指定每页返回的订单数量,最大值不能超过 50。该参数与 offset 配合使用,实现分页功能</td>
</tr>
<tr>
<td>过滤订单状态</td>
<td>status</td>
<td>否</td>
<td>Int</td>
<td>1</td>
<td>用于筛选订单状态,0 代表未支付,1 代表已支付。若不填写该参数,则返回所有状态的订单</td>
</tr>
<tr>
<td>当前时间戳</td>
<td>timestamp</td>
<td>是</td>
<td>String</td>
<td>1721206072</td>
<td>10 位整数,单位为秒,用于校验请求的时效性,防止请求被重放攻击</td>
</tr>
<tr>
<td>签名字符串</td>
<td>sign</td>
<td>是</td>
<td>String</td>
<td>-</td>
<td>按照特定签名规则生成的字符串,用于验证请求数据的完整性和真实性,确保请求未被篡改</td>
</tr>
<tr>
<td>签名类型</td>
<td>sign_type</td>
<td>是</td>
<td>String</td>
<td>RSA</td>
<td>默认采用 RSA 签名算法,指示签名所使用的具体算法</td>
</tr>
</tbody>
</table>
<h2>四、返回参数说明</h2>
<table>
<thead>
<tr>
<th>字段名</th>
<th>变量名</th>
<th>类型</th>
<th>示例值</th>
<th>描述</th>
</tr>
</thead>
<tbody>
<tr>
<td>返回状态码</td>
<td>code</td>
<td>Int</td>
<td>0</td>
<td>0 表示查询成功,其他值表示失败。开发者可根据错误码进一步排查问题</td>
</tr>
<tr>
<td>返回信息</td>
<td>msg</td>
<td>String</td>
<td>-</td>
<td>当查询成功或失败时,返回的提示信息,帮助开发者了解操作结果</td>
</tr>
<tr>
<td>订单列表</td>
<td>data</td>
<td>Array</td>
<td>-</td>
<td>包含订单信息的数组,数组中每个元素的具体参数可参考订单查询接口文档。该数组存储了符合查询条件的订单数据</td>
</tr>
<tr>
<td>当前时间戳</td>
<td>timestamp</td>
<td>String</td>
<td>1721206072</td>
<td>10 位整数,单位为秒,用于校验返回数据的时效性</td>
</tr>
<tr>
<td>签名字符串</td>
<td>sign</td>
<td>String</td>
<td>-</td>
<td>用于验证返回数据的合法性,确保数据未被篡改,参考签名规则生成</td>
</tr>
<tr>
<td>签名类型</td>
<td>sign_type</td>
<td>String</td>
<td>RSA</td>
<td>默认采用 RSA 签名算法,指示签名所使用的具体算</td>
</tr>
</tbody>
</table>